Tour description
Welcome to my favorite tour in town!
On this great trip in heart of Santiago, you will visit one of the best lookouts downtown in a gorgeous island-hill park in the middle of the city where you will be able to discover the hidden history of the park (there is no info at the park if you go on your own); you will be able to discover nature and also to look at the Andes mountain range!; you will also be able to visit other main attractions linked to arts, culture, history, and food nearby the hill.
If you like short hikes, parks, nature, photography, history, geography, culture, arts, food, and also current affairs, this tour has the perfect mixture of all these topics!
